Originally Posted by gzsg
Rumor on the other forum the AF/KLM scope grievance is settled for $60 million. $5000 per pilot.

If true, I think settling for cash is a mistake. We need a permanent improvement to the PWA like 5:15 per vacation day.

We also need them to be in compliance going forward.

And the new scope language needs to have a 12 month limit to any future noncompliance and specific and immediate penalties. I.e. 6 hours per vacation day until back in compliance.

The penalty needs to be painful enough to make them want to fight to get back in compliance.

This violation caused many jobs and promotions. Selling scope for money is a VERY SLIPPERY SLOPE.

Jerry
How can we settle something when the violation has yet to occur? Another strike by the AF pilots next quarter and the company might well be in compliance. Usually settlements occur after the violation.

Originally Posted by sailingfun
Unless one of the CA's was a LCA its not legal since a Captain can't occupy the right seat. Hard to make the breaks work out with that restriction.
When NWA first got the A330 every flight was 2 CA/1FO since none of the FO's were typed. One CA would be in the left seat for T/O, the other for landing.
Also, I am not sure if it is still correct, but I believe every Captain is technically qualified in the right seat but can only be re-scheduled into that seat away from base.
